自动化工具 周末捣鼓了一下,使用自然语言触发接口测试,降低接口自动化门槛

flyfisher · January 25, 2026 · 50 hits

目标:一句话就能调用某个接口

一直觉得接口测试工具的使用门槛还不够低,就想封装一下常用的测试库,实现基于自然语言的接口测试。

周末捣鼓了一下:
(1)首先使用 yaml 接口定义接口调用参数和返回值校验规则,使用 ${search_text}占位符替换动态参数

(2)然后编辑一份 robot 测试脚本,就可以实现接口调用了

这样已经大幅降低编程要求了。如果预制关键字不能满足要求,就自己学学 python 扩展一下,这种情况应该不多。

对使用人员要求:了解 http 接口调用方式、了解 jsonschema、jsonpath、yaml 文件规则、会安装 python 环境。

大家要是觉得有用,我再完善一下,分享给大家。

No Reply at the moment.
需要 Sign In 后方可回复, 如果你还没有账号请点击这里 Sign Up